Plastic Surgery Nurse Salary in Illinois

How much does a Plastic Surgery Nurse make in Illinois?

As of August 01, 2026, the average salary for a Plastic Surgery Nurse in Illinois is $115,397 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$55.

However, a Plastic Surgery Nurse's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$128,393
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$108,637 to $122,200
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$102,482

How Experience Level Affects Plastic Surgery Nurse Salaries?

Experience is a primary driver of a Plastic Surgery Nurse's salary. As you build your skills and take on more complex tasks, your compensation generally increases. Here’s how the average salary grows at different career stages:

  • Entry-Level (less than 1 year): $114,740
  • Early Career (1-2 years): $115,210
  • Mid-Level (2-4 years): $115,867
  • Senior-Level (5-8 years): $117,026
  • Expert (over 8 years): $119,227

Plastic Surgery Nurse Salary by Industry: Top Paying Sectors

For Plastic Surgery Nurse roles, the industry you choose can impact your earning potential by as much as 25% (the gap between the highest and lowest paying industries). Data shows that the highest-paying industry, Healthcare, offers compensation 10% above the average. Conversely, Plastic Surgery Nurse positions in Edu., Gov't. & Nonprofit typically offer lower base pay, as this sector often view Plastic Surgery Nurse as a support function rather than a direct revenue driver.
